What Sorts of Insurance policy Protection Are Available?
Long range relocating firms normally use several sorts of insurance protection:
Basic Coverage: This is generally included at no extra expense and gives very little defense-- commonly around 60 cents per extra pound per item.
Full Worth Protection: This even more comprehensive alternative covers the total value of your belongings, indicating if a thing is lost or harmed throughout transportation, you will be repaid based on its current market value.
Third-Party Insurance: For those looking for even more extensive protection beyond what movers provide, third-party insurance companies can offer tailored plans that suit specific needs.

Common Questions About Long Distance Movers' Insurance Options
What is Basic Coverage?
Basic insurance coverage is a marginal degree of responsibility that covers losses due to harm or loss throughout transport at 60 cents per pound per item.
How Does Full Value Defense Work?
Under amount security, if products are lost or harmed, movers are responsible for either fixing or changing those things based upon their present market value.
Is Third-Party Insurance policy Necessary?
While not compulsory, third-party insurance offers additional security if you have high-value things that may surpass what typical moving company plans cover.
Are There Exclusions in Moving Insurance Policy Policies?
Yes! Most plans feature exemptions like certain high-value products (jewelry, antiques) unless particularly detailed and insured separately.
